emerion Powers VPS Offerings with Parallels Virtualization Virtuozzo Containers

emerion vServers Also Use Parallels Plesk Control Panel and Parallels Business Automation Software

emerion WebHosting is using Parallels Virtuozzo Containers to power new virtual private server (VPS) offerings for its customers.

emerion vServers also use Parallels Plesk Control Panel and Parallels Business Automation software to provide a complete solution for managing VPS services, including billing and provisioning.

The new emerion vServers for Linux are available with three service plans to accommodate from 300 GB up to 1,500 GB of monthly traffic. Each vServer includes root access and up to 1 GB burstable RAM with SSH, root login, a dedicated IP address and web-based server maintenance for re-start and recovery.

Parallels Virtuozzo Containers is an operating system (OS) virtualization solution, featuring high levels of density, performance and manageability. On a single physical server and single OS installation, it enables users to run workloads in multiple, simultaneously running execution environments called "containers".

The Parallels Open Platform enables hosting with Parallels virtualization and automation technology through integration with a wide range of third-party applications and systems. The Application Packaging Standard (APS), a key element of the platform, is used by ISVs and service providers to seamlessly integrate applications to offer to the more than 10 million businesses and individuals that use Parallels products.
